    If you prefer to play female avatars in game, Black Gold Online has a new class just for you. Snail Games unveiled the new Occultist class, a female-only support healer and ranged DPS that sports leather armor. With a low resistance to damage, Occultists rely on sapping and stunning their enemies while replenishing the stamina of her group and providing heals. The Occultist joins Black Gold's line up alongside the recently revealed Spellsword class, the Pyromancer, the Assassin, and more.   • Black Gold Online video shows off action combat system

    by 
    MJ Guthrie
    MJ Guthrie
    12.18.2013

    Whether you prefer the steampunk or the fantasy faction, if you are a fan of dodging and constant movement to try and out-maneuver your opponents, combat in Black Gold Online should be right up your alley. In the latest feature unveiling, developers delve into the ins and outs of combat in the upcoming game, eschewing the traditional stand-still-and-button-mash version of combat in favor of some action. Most skills in the upcoming game are collision, or hit-box-based, and melee fighters will move in the direction they are facing with every swing. Ranged works a bit differently: Although most ranged skills will remain locked on their target, some will require players to anticipate enemy movements and target accordingly. And don't forget these battles also involve vehicles! While mounted, players will be in FPS mode. Get a preview of Black Gold Online's combat in action in the trailer below.   • Age of Wushu introducing school betrayals

    by 
    Eliot Lefebvre
    Eliot Lefebvre
    12.10.2013

    Traditionally, your school in Age of Wushu isn't something that changes. Once you've signed on with a school, that's your home forever. But with the upcoming betrayal mechanics, you can move from being a dedicated partisan of one school to being an initiate of another. And you aren't even just limited to changing schools because you were kicked out of the first one, since the game offers several departure options for those who want to see how the other half lives. Betrayal is the obvious choice, which will allow you to immediately leave with the cost of losing your school-specific identity, titles, internal skills, fashion... you get the idea. In trade, you can join any of the seven other schools or one of the new sects launching with the next major update. The Excursion route still takes your identity, titles, and fashion, but your internal skills are merely lowered. Incognito takes this a step further, merely locking your titles and such while leaving your first three skill slots unaffected. These latter two options allow you to explore the new sects with lesser consequence, but both are meant to be more costly and time-consuming. It's up to you if you want to continue to be loyal or start walking the path of betrayal.

  • Black Gold Online unveils The Chambers of Greed instances

    by 
    MJ Guthrie
    MJ Guthrie
    12.05.2013

    A new feature is coming to Black Gold Online in addition to the main quest-line and normal dungeons that players already enjoy: The Chambers of Greed. These instances chambers, or greed pockets, bring variety to the game by offering challenging side activities that blend PvE and PvP and give another avenue for acquiring new gear by slaying higher level monsters and completing assorted other tasks. Unlike the openness of the over-world, The Greed Chambers have a darker, mysterious ambiance aimed at making players watch their every step. These chambers, which are more challenging that quests of the same level, will have hidden entrances to get inside. Players will need to discover these entrances themselves by getting in close, slaying a gatekeeper, or tripping some other trigger. Peek inside these new instances in the video below.   • Scope out Black Gold Online's vehicular combat in new trailer

    by 
    MJ Guthrie
    MJ Guthrie
    11.21.2013

    By air or by land, Black Gold Online offers players a variety of transportation options that do more than just get you to the battle, but also take part in it! Muscled mounts face off against mechanized ones as The Erlandir Union (the fantasy faction) and The Kingdom of Isenhorst (steampunk faction) duke it out to get control of a mysterious energy substance. An essential part of Black Gold Online's PvP system, these mechanical mechs, war hounds, flying machines, and dragons can all be summoned in battlegrounds for PvP objectives as well as the open world. Players obtain these Raid, Aerial, Anti-Air, Penetration, and Assault vehicles through both questing and battleground achievements, and each mount has its own achievement path and customization options.   • Lifting the veil on Age of Wushu's marriage system

    by 
    MJ Guthrie
    MJ Guthrie
    11.07.2013

    Many people consider a wedding day to be a big deal, and Age of Wushu's upcoming marriage system provides a good helping of pomp and circumstance to accompany player nuptials. When the Ultimate Scrolls expansion hits next week, players will be able to tie the knot in an elaborate in-game ceremony that includes a a parade through the city, a banquet (that friends can attend and foes crash), and a dance show provided by the new couple. For those who don't yet have a companion, the marriage system has you covered: Unattached characters can register with the Matchmaker in hopes of finding a suitable suitor. Once you find your match, male characters have to do the proposing by offering a betrothal gift (a self-determined amount of Taels) that, if accepted, starts the whole process rolling. Men, have your money pouches ready because you also have to spring for the wedding package!
